WebSample results: •Most results for high flow sampling (dust or gravimetric sampling) are reported in milligrams (mg) •Correction of your result into mg/m3 is important for direct comparison to the OEL in mg/m3 •In real terms you rarely sample exactly 1m3 of air so the dust weight is representative of the amount of dust in the air volume you have WebGravimetric analysis or gravimetry refers to the quantitative determination of a chemical constituent using mass or weight measurements. The unknown chemical constituent (A) to be determined is converted into a substance of known composition (AB) by carrying out a chemical reaction.

WebGravimetric analysis describes a set of methods used in analytical chemistry for the quantitative determination of an analyte (the ion being analyzed) based on its mass. The principle of this type of analysis is that once an ion's mass has been determined as a unique compound, that known measurement can then be used to determine the same ...
